How To Hard Boil Eggs In Microwave?
After answering the question can you hard boil an egg in a microwave. Learn how to safely boil eggs in the microwave!
See more: : How Long To Boil Quail Eggs | How To Boil Quail Eggs
The first step to boiling eggs in the microwave is to poke a hole at the top and bottom of the egg with a toothpick or similar object. This can help release any steam that can build up during the cooking process which can prevent it from exploding. The next step is to place the egg into a bowl of water and cover it with a microwave-safe lid. Finally, you can cook the egg on high power for two minutes and then allow it to sit for an additional two minutes before transferring it to an ice bath to cool down.

How Long To Boil Eggs In Microwave?
The time it takes to boil an egg in the microwave can vary depending on the wattage of your microwave and how many eggs you are boiling at once. Generally, it can take anywhere from two to four minutes for one egg to cook in the microwave. If you are boiling multiple eggs, then it can take up to five or six minutes for them to cook completely. It is important to note that you will need to adjust the cooking time depending on how hard or soft you want your eggs to be.

What happens if you put an egg in the microwave?
See more: : How Long Is Cooked Sausage Good For In The Fridge
If you put an egg in the microwave, it can be a dangerous and potentially explosive experiment. The heat from the microwaves causes pressure to build up inside of the egg as steam is created faster than it can escape. If left in too long, this pressure will eventually cause the egg to explode, sending hot egg matter everywhere and potentially causing burns. If you want to safely cook an egg in the microwave, it’s best to use a specially designed container that will allow steam to escape.
